Just brought it home a couple days ago. Trying to learn what's what & where it is. Figured out that the ski locker drains into the engine compartment. I looked at several boats and they all had some water in the engine compartment. On my boat, the bilge pump looks like it's a retrofit and does not reach the lowest part of the hull, leaves a bit behind, I plan to replace it. It's pretty easy to shop-vac the standing water out - how much water in the engine compartment do you folks tolerate? Any recommendations on bilge pump? Also, the port locker on deck has a drain hole, does this drain to the engine compartment as well? I would guess the starboard deck locker drains also but there's a fire extinguisher bracket in the way and I can't see a drain hole. Thanks.
 
Most of the compartments drain into the bilge
The seating floor area drains overboard through a check valve
I personally hate seeing water in the bilge and vacuum it dry when boat not in use and leave bilge drain plug open for ventilation
